Approval of the National League of Cities Advancing Economic Mobility Grant in the Amount of $15,000
OVERVIEW STATEMENT:
recommendation
City staff is seeking approval from City Council to authorize the Mayor to accept a National League of Cities (NLC) Grant in the amount of $15,000. Funds will be used to hire a consultant to facilitate and work with a coalition of partners to maximize the opportunity for developing a Multicultural Eastside Small Business Hub in the Bellwether Housing Overlake Village light rail station transit-oriented development (TOD).

REQUEST RATIONALE:
* Relevant Plans/Policies:
2030 Comprehensive Plan Policies:
EV-9: Encourage and recognize incubator space in Redmond for existing and future small businesses.
EV-19: Participate in partnerships with other agencies, businesses, nonprofits and other organizations that further the City's economic vitality goals.
EV-20: Implement, in conjunction with business, education and other community partners, the Strategic Plan for Economic Development to...Identify strategies to retain existing businesses and help them succeed;
EV-21: Initiate or participate in the following activities in support of economic vitality:
? Monitor future trends and economic conditions;
? Prepare information for businesses on available public sector financing;
? Support federal and state funding of cost effective business financing programs;
